It's been Mexican food all weekend.

It started with yummy steaks that were marinated 48 hours. The marinade consists of cilantro, lime juice, toasted cumin seeds and 4 jalapeños. It is not aesthetically pleasing, but the flavor is awesome. We used pre-made tortillas, but cooked at home. That way we can get the consistency just right. I treated P to home made salsa. Roma tomatoes, white onion, a jalapeño, lime juice and cilantro. The only problem is that the jalapeños were potent, and seeding 5 of those huge puppies left me with a sneezing fit.
